15 – kanálového kódování

Úvodních

kanál je abstraktní model popisující, jak byly obdrženy (nebo získat) dat je spojena s přenášeny (nebo uložené) data. Kódování kanálů začíná matematickou teorií komunikace Clauda Shannona.

kódování detekce/korekce chyb

kódování kanálu může být buď kódování detekce chyb nebo kódování korekce chyb. Pokud je použito pouze kódování detekce chyb, přijímač může požádat o opakování přenosu a tato technika je známá jako automatický požadavek na opakování (ARQ). To vyžaduje obousměrnou komunikaci. Systém ARQ vyžaduje kód s dobrou schopností detekovat chyby, takže pravděpodobnost nezjištěné chyby je velmi malá.

kódování Forward error correction (FEC) umožňuje opravu chyb na základě přijatých informací a je důležitější pro dosažení vysoce spolehlivé komunikace při rychlostech blížících se kapacitě kanálu. Například turbo kódováním odpovídá Nekódovaný BER 10-3 kódovanému BER 10-6 po turbo dekódování. Pro aplikace, které používají simplex (jednosměrné) kanály, musí být podporováno kódování FEC, protože přijímač musí detekovat a opravovat chyby a pro žádosti o opakovaný přenos není k dispozici žádný zpětný kanál.

další metodou používající kódování detekce chyb je skrytí chyb. Tato metoda zpracovává data tak, aby byl účinek chyb minimalizován. Utajení chyb je zvláště užitečné pro aplikace, které přenášejí data pro Subjektivní zhodnocení, jako je řeč, Hudba, obrázek a video. Ztráta části dat je přijatelná, protože v datech stále existuje určitá vlastní redundance.

Napsat komentář

Vaše e-mailová adresa nebude zveřejněna.